About

Yao‐Chung Wu is a scholar working on Cancer Research, Molecular Biology and Oncology. According to data from OpenAlex, Yao‐Chung Wu has authored 13 papers receiving a total of 345 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Cancer Research, 4 papers in Molecular Biology and 4 papers in Oncology. Recurrent topics in Yao‐Chung Wu’s work include Cancer, Hypoxia, and Metabolism (3 papers), Mitochondrial Function and Pathology (2 papers) and Cancer-related Molecular Pathways (2 papers). Yao‐Chung Wu is often cited by papers focused on Cancer, Hypoxia, and Metabolism (3 papers), Mitochondrial Function and Pathology (2 papers) and Cancer-related Molecular Pathways (2 papers). Yao‐Chung Wu collaborates with scholars based in Taiwan, United States and China. Yao‐Chung Wu's co-authors include Shou‐Jen Kuo, Shou‐Tung Chen, Chin‐San Liu, Jui‐Chih Chang, Ta‐Tsung Lin, Wen‐Ling Cheng, Dar‐Ren Chen, Yufen Wang, Chu-Chung Chou and Hung‐Wen Lai and has published in prestigious journals such as Annals of Surgery, Fertility and Sterility and Frontiers in Psychology.
